葉光海
(贛州經(jīng)緯科技股份有限公司,江西贛州 341000)
齒輪的傳動是機(jī)械裝備的重要組成部分和基礎(chǔ)元件,在國民經(jīng)濟(jì)、生產(chǎn)生活中有著廣泛的應(yīng)用。特別是近年來,作為國家力推的新能源汽車,純電動汽車的應(yīng)用越來越廣。純電動汽車由于動力源采用了電機(jī)替代傳統(tǒng)汽車的發(fā)動機(jī),對整車的NVH提出了更高的要求,減速器作為純電動汽車的重要部件之一,也是動力傳動部件,其核心元件為齒輪。在整車的動力性、經(jīng)濟(jì)性及NVH的分析和研究過程中,齒輪是必不可少的研究和優(yōu)化的課題。而齒輪為滿足整車各項(xiàng)性能指標(biāo)的要求,原有的齒輪標(biāo)準(zhǔn)化參數(shù)無法適用實(shí)際應(yīng)用的要求。因此目前市場上幾乎所有應(yīng)用于汽車變速器、減速器等部件上的齒輪基本上是基于各整車系統(tǒng)的需要進(jìn)行優(yōu)化精準(zhǔn)設(shè)計(jì)的非標(biāo)準(zhǔn)齒輪。為提高產(chǎn)品研發(fā)效率及研發(fā)質(zhì)量,3D數(shù)模設(shè)計(jì)、有限元分析、仿真分析等手段被廣泛采用。為獲得精準(zhǔn)的系統(tǒng)設(shè)計(jì)分析結(jié)果,減少與實(shí)物的誤差,降低開發(fā)成本,精準(zhǔn)的零件3D數(shù)模設(shè)計(jì)就顯得尤為重要。本文作者將從齒輪參數(shù)的選擇與定義,創(chuàng)建齒槽輪廓及螺旋線,創(chuàng)建齒輪3D數(shù)模等方面來闡述漸開線非標(biāo)準(zhǔn)圓柱齒輪精確建模的方法。
文中將以運(yùn)用于某純電動汽車減速器的漸開線非標(biāo)準(zhǔn)圓柱斜齒輪副為例,研究基于CATIA軟件進(jìn)行全參數(shù)化精確建模的方法。目前基于CATIA軟件漸開線齒輪參數(shù)化建?;蚨伍_發(fā)的相關(guān)論文也不少,但大部分是基于標(biāo)準(zhǔn)齒輪參數(shù),建模步驟大同小異,文中重點(diǎn)探討漸開線非標(biāo)圓柱斜齒輪副如何精確建模的方法。
首先在零件設(shè)計(jì)模塊創(chuàng)建零件名稱及代號,然后通過知識工程模塊中的f(x)新建并定義以下齒輪副參數(shù)[2],詳見表1。
表1 齒輪副參數(shù)
需要說明的是由于漸開線非標(biāo)準(zhǔn)圓柱斜齒輪,有些參數(shù)如齒頂高系數(shù)、頂隙系數(shù)等兩配對齒輪通常可能不一樣,有時(shí)需要采用配對齒輪的參數(shù)進(jìn)行計(jì)算和建模。如齒輪齒根高的計(jì)算將采用配對齒輪的齒頂高系數(shù)及頂隙系數(shù)來計(jì)算
hf=(hap2+cn2-xn1)·mn·1 mm
(1)
式中:“1 mm”是CATIA軟件為hf參數(shù)定義的單位為米制,因hap2、cn2、xn1及mn都沒有帶單位。
在新建參數(shù)的過程中需注意選擇參數(shù)的類型,如整數(shù)、實(shí)數(shù)、角度等。新建好參數(shù)后,可以參考《齒輪傳動設(shè)計(jì)手冊》[2]等含有齒輪設(shè)計(jì)的工具書,在CATIA軟件知識工程模塊中的f(x)建立各參數(shù)之間的關(guān)系式,創(chuàng)建和定義完成后,如圖1所示(圖中所示數(shù)值為文中示例齒輪參數(shù))。
在上述參數(shù)新建完成輸入對應(yīng)的齒輪參數(shù)數(shù)值并建立齒輪相關(guān)參數(shù)關(guān)系式后,進(jìn)入創(chuàng)成式外形設(shè)計(jì)(GSD)模塊,就可以開始進(jìn)行齒廓?jiǎng)?chuàng)建了,文中以齒槽輪廓的創(chuàng)建為例進(jìn)行探討:
(1)在同一坐標(biāo)基準(zhǔn)面(文中為XY基準(zhǔn)面)上分別給制分度圓、齒頂圓、齒根圓和基圓,并通過編輯公式標(biāo)注各圓半徑尺寸r、ra、rf及rb建立函數(shù)關(guān)系(為避免CATIA軟件部分版本自動生成實(shí)體時(shí)齒槽剪切可能出錯(cuò),齒槽輪廓的齒頂圓半徑以(ra+2)mm輸入);
(2)創(chuàng)建漸開線方程,通過知識工程中的fog建立法則曲線x及法則曲線y,即齒輪輪齒的漸開線方程[2]為:
(2)
式中:變量t類型為實(shí)數(shù);x、y類型為長度,“1 rad”表該參數(shù)為弧度而不是角度值,如圖2所示。
(3)創(chuàng)建漸開線上的點(diǎn),坐標(biāo)尺寸標(biāo)注時(shí)通過編輯公式引用應(yīng)用法則曲線x,法則曲線y,并對變量t輸入從0~0.4間間隔均等的200~300對數(shù)值,對應(yīng)創(chuàng)建了漸開線上相同數(shù)量的點(diǎn),理論上創(chuàng)建的點(diǎn)越多精度越高,實(shí)際應(yīng)用中有300左右精度夠用;
(4)通過樣條線命令創(chuàng)建漸開線,即將第三步創(chuàng)建的所有點(diǎn)連接生成漸開線;
(5)創(chuàng)建漸開線與分度圓交點(diǎn),該點(diǎn)將是創(chuàng)建漸開線基準(zhǔn)面及螺旋線起始基準(zhǔn)點(diǎn);
(6)創(chuàng)建漸開線齒廓基準(zhǔn)面,以第五步創(chuàng)建點(diǎn)及漸開線所在平面的坐標(biāo)軸進(jìn)行創(chuàng)建;
(7)創(chuàng)建對稱基準(zhǔn)面,即齒槽兩側(cè)漸開線對稱基準(zhǔn)面,對稱基準(zhǔn)面的旋轉(zhuǎn)角度通過編輯尺寸輸入以下公式進(jìn)行定義[1-2]:
也就是半個(gè)端面齒槽的夾角,須考慮齒輪變位及齒厚公差的影響,這將決定所建數(shù)模齒厚的精度;
(8)創(chuàng)建齒根圓弧,在漸開線與齒根圓及厚公差中值Ts開線與齒根圓之間創(chuàng)建圓弧,通過編輯公式定義圓弧尺寸為rc·mn·1 mm;
(9)應(yīng)用分割和接合命令對漸開線、齒頂圓、對稱漸開線、齒根圓弧、齒根圓多余的部分進(jìn)行分割裁剪,對裁剪剩余部分進(jìn)行接合,最終形成齒槽端面輪廓;
(10)創(chuàng)建螺旋線,以步驟(5)創(chuàng)建的點(diǎn)為起始點(diǎn),以z軸為中軸線,以齒寬b為高度,以螺旋線導(dǎo)程2·PI·r/tanβ為螺距的螺旋線,方向定義為左旋齒選擇順時(shí)針,右旋齒選擇逆時(shí)針[1-2]。通過以上創(chuàng)建,結(jié)果如圖3所示。
步驟(1)—(10)都是在CATIA軟件中的創(chuàng)成式外形設(shè)計(jì)(GSD)模塊中進(jìn)行設(shè)計(jì),通過創(chuàng)建基準(zhǔn)點(diǎn)、基準(zhǔn)面、齒輪各要素圓、圓弧及漸開線等完成了目標(biāo)齒輪一個(gè)端面齒槽輪廓的創(chuàng)建,并通過螺旋線命令及其參數(shù)方程創(chuàng)建了斜齒輪分度圓上的螺旋線曲線。
下一步可以在CATIA軟件中從當(dāng)前模塊切換到零件設(shè)計(jì)模塊,進(jìn)行圓柱斜齒輪3D數(shù)模創(chuàng)建:首先,創(chuàng)建齒輪坯實(shí)體,以坐標(biāo)系XY平面為支持面,草繪外徑為齒頂圓直徑,尺寸標(biāo)注通過編輯公式輸入半徑值為ra,通過凸臺命名進(jìn)行拉伸,拉伸高度通過編輯公式輸入齒寬值b;其次,創(chuàng)建首個(gè)齒槽,通過開槽命令,輪廓選取第2節(jié)中步驟(9)創(chuàng)建的齒槽端面輪廓,中心曲線選取已創(chuàng)建的螺旋線,控制輪廓選取參考曲面并選擇XY平面,然后確定,首個(gè)齒槽創(chuàng)建完成(注:對于漸開線非標(biāo)圓柱直齒輪,此步驟僅需采用凹槽命令對齒槽端面輪廓拉伸即可);最后,完成所有齒的創(chuàng)建,通過圓周陣列命令,將上一步創(chuàng)建的首個(gè)齒槽進(jìn)行等角間距圓周陣列,實(shí)例欄通過編輯公式輸入z1,角間距通過編輯公式輸入360°/z1,參考方向選z軸,對象選首個(gè)創(chuàng)建的齒槽,然后確定;這樣漸開線非標(biāo)準(zhǔn)圓柱斜齒輪的數(shù)模就已經(jīng)創(chuàng)建完成,如圖4所示。并且是帶參數(shù)的,可以直接通過修改結(jié)構(gòu)樹中的參數(shù)或通過知識工程中的f(x)對齒輪參數(shù)進(jìn)行修改,或輸入新的齒輪參數(shù)新設(shè)計(jì)一個(gè)齒輪,無需重復(fù)上述建模過程,將自動生成一個(gè)新的齒輪數(shù)模。
文中基于CATIA軟件,對漸開線非標(biāo)準(zhǔn)圓柱齒輪副的全參數(shù)化建模方法進(jìn)行了研究,文中所述的非標(biāo)準(zhǔn)圓柱齒輪主要是指齒輪參數(shù)的非標(biāo)準(zhǔn)化而非結(jié)構(gòu)上的非標(biāo)準(zhǔn),部分參數(shù)需要通過齒輪副或配對齒輪的參數(shù)來進(jìn)行定義,如齒根高、變位等?;诰珳?zhǔn)參數(shù)建模需要,將齒厚、齒頂、齒根等公差納入相應(yīng)的建模方程或公式,以實(shí)現(xiàn)自動生成精準(zhǔn)數(shù)模。經(jīng)對比,參數(shù)化建模方法生成的齒輪數(shù)模與目前廣泛應(yīng)用的齒輪專業(yè)設(shè)計(jì)軟件Kisssoft導(dǎo)出的3D實(shí)體齒輪精度相當(dāng)。可以直接用于進(jìn)一步的功能或可靠性仿真或有限元設(shè)計(jì)分析和優(yōu)化,并且數(shù)模的變更或新設(shè)計(jì)僅需修改相關(guān)的參數(shù)就能實(shí)現(xiàn),大大提高了齒輪數(shù)模的設(shè)計(jì)效率。
該方法也適用于漸開線非標(biāo)準(zhǔn)圓柱直齒輪的參數(shù)化建模,只需取消螺旋角β參數(shù)及螺旋線就可實(shí)現(xiàn)。